    Do you want to be a part of an exciting, growing school? Do you want to make a difference every day and work with an amazing HR team? Then please join us as an onsite Sr. Employee Relations Specialist at our Corporate Headquarters, where you will be directly responsible for the development and administration of the employee relations program, including but not limited to the employee onboarding experience, performance management, discipline, time & attendance, employee advocacy/engagement and affirmative action. This position interfaces with all levels of employees/management, government agencies, legal and other third party entities.

     

    Full Time or Part Time opportunity!

     

    Hours: Full Time = Mon - Fri 8a - 5p; Part Time = Mon - Fri 9a - 2:30p

    Reporting to the VP Human Resources, the successful candidate will:

    + Serve as the primary contact and liaison for intake and assessment of employee performance and misconduct issues.

    + Instruct, collaborate and participate with management on employee investigations on matters such as harassment allegations, workplace complaints, or other concerns.

    + Provide advice and guidance to all levels of management on employee performance and misconduct conduct issues.

    + Create employee policies and procedures.

    + Consult with the VP HR and legal counsel as needed on more complex employee matters involving multiple laws and regulations.

    + Participate in documentation and continuous improvement of HR policies and procedures.

    + Conduct surveys, interviews, and other research related to human resource policies, employee engagement and compensation.

    + Assist with preparation of plans, policies, documents, and reports including EEO-1, affirmative action plans, and employee and management handbooks.

    + Administer the equal employment opportunity and affirmative action programs.

    + Conduct exit interviews, summarizes findings, and discusses trends and concerns with senior management.

    + Create and present training materials on a variety of employee topics to employees at all levels.

    + Draft communication plans and messaging on behalf of senior leadership regarding HR topics.

    + Remain current on knowledge and understanding of laws and regulations related to employment law, EEO, affirmative action, compensation, time and attendance, etc

    Position Requirements:

    + Bachelors’ degree required, preferably in Human Resources, Business Administration or related field.

    + Minimum 5 years HR Generalist or Employee Relations Specialist experience required with minimum of two years’ experience independently handling employee relations issues required.

    + HR Certification Institute Senior Professional in HR (SPHR) / Professional in HR (PHR) OR SHRM Senior Certified Professional (SHRM-SCP) / SHRM Certified Professional (SHRM-CP) strongly preferred.

    + Knowledge of Equal Employment Opportunity and affirmative action requirements.

    + Thorough understanding of feder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ations with the ability to comprehend, interpret, and apply these.

    + Strong analytical, problem-solving skills and critical thinking skills.

    + Strong proficiency with MS Office, internet sourcing, and proprietary software

    + Strong written and oral communication skills

    + Excellent interpersonal, counseling and conflict resolution skills.

    + Excellent organization and time management skills

     

    Travel Requirements: Up to 20% of travel expected to other campus locations as needed.

    About our company:

    Porter and Chester Institute, a leading trade school in Connecticut and Massachusetts for 75 years, adheres to one basic vision: to educate and train our students to the level that will make them competent employees. With 7 campus locations throughout Connecticut and Massachusetts, we offer training in such trades as Automotive Technology, HVAC-R, CAD, Electrician, Plumbing, as well as Medical Assisting, Dental Assisting, Practical Nursing and Computer & Technology.

     

    Our support staff, including Admissions, Financial Aid and other administrative professionals, to our highly qualified Instructors are focused on making the students' experience a fulfilling and enriching one, both professionally and personally.
